Despite being a master of glitchy electronic sounds, Dan Deacon's highbrow compositional chops and DIY ethos make him a better fit for an underground punk venue than a big EDM club. Deacon's performances, which usually involve directed crowd-participation dance-offs, are sweaty, euphoric affairs. This show, which comes on the heels of his latest album, Gliss Riffer, should be no different—perfect for closing out the year.
